Check the underside of the underhood fuse box for the ELD. Also, disconnect battery, charge overnight, morning voltage should be about 12.5 volts. Connect battery, start car and monitor your voltage. Make sure you have radio and nav codes. Do a google search on 'remy honda charging system'.Usually, a fully charged battery should be around 12.6 volts or more. You can use a digital multimeter to check the voltage of your car's battery. But, when the alternator is charging, the voltage of the battery should be 13.5-14.5 volts. Once the battery light is on with the voltage above 13 volts, there's something wrong with the alternator.Cause 2: Battery Gone Bad. If your car battery is bad, it can cause many problems. Mar 25, 2017 · The belt is driven by the engine via the crankshaft pulley. It drives the air conditioning compressor, alternator, water pump, and power steering pumps. If the belt broke or came off due either to age, or if possibly the belt tensioner. If the belt came off or broke, the alter will not provide power and the battery warning light will come on.

It can cause your car’s battery light, “Check Charging System” message, and engine light to illuminate if the Engine Control Unit (ECU) is malfunctioning.449 posts · Joined 2015. #8 · Aug 21, 2019. You need to do a parasitic draw test using a multi-meter at the battery, while pulling and re-inserting fuses or relays, while observing the amp draw on the meter at the same time. This is not very hard, a multi-meter costs as little as $10 from auto parts stores or walmart.John Clark said: Clearing codes has nothing to do with this issue.
